Across TCGA patient cohorts, ADORA2B RNA expression is significantly associated with the RNA expression of many other genes, with 17,605 significant associations in total. UVM shows the largest number of these associations.

The most reproducible ADORA2B-associated genes across cancer lineages are LDHA, TSR1, and CRK. Each is linked with ADORA2B in more than 28 cancer types. Because this analysis shows association rather than direction, both ADORA2B-to-partner and partner-to-ADORA2B results are reported.

Each partner links to its own Q-omics profile. The scatter plot shows the strongest example, ADORA2B versus LDHA in BLCA, with a Pearson correlation of 0.53.
